Technical Analysis

From a technical perspective, GIGM has two key price levels that traders and analysts are watching closely in current trading. The first is a key support level at $1.25, a price point that the stock has tested multiple times in recent weeks, with observable buying interest emerging each time price approaches this threshold. The longer-term moving average also sits near this support level, adding further confluence to the $1.25 zone as a key area of potential buying interest. On the upside, GIGM faces a key resistance level at $1.39, a recent swing high that the stock has failed to break through on multiple occasions in the past month, with selling pressure picking up consistently near this price point. The stock’s relative strength index (RSI) is currently in the low 40s, a range that signals neither extreme oversold nor overbought conditions, suggesting there is room for price movement in either direction before technical momentum indicators flash extreme readings. The short-term moving average is trading just below the current $1.32 price, acting as a minor near-term support level for intraday trading moves.
